Output d9d2861c95aa42a4f7531388c12ecb6ab1c70f982acc5da424df852cb01e878f:0

value
10081206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23e38d890f4832802fce6f321ce9dc0af20767f7 OP_EQUAL
address
MBAvUo4hrdz56AECdG48STPrmpXEnL6i3z
transaction
d9d2861c95aa42a4f7531388c12ecb6ab1c70f982acc5da424df852cb01e878f
spent
true